CZML是一种JSON格式,因此可以直接在程序中描述成对象字面量。具体实现代码如下: 代码语言:javascript 复制 'use strict';varczml=[{"id":"document","name":"CZML Point","version":"1.0"},{"id":"point 1","name":"point","position":{"cartographicDegrees":[-111.0,40.0,0]},"point":{"color":{...
CZML(Cesium Language) 是一种基于JSON格式的数据交换标记语言,用于描述三维场景中的对象、图形、传感器和装置等。CZML格式旨在提供例如位置、旋转、缩放和材质等属性数据信息,用于实现逼真的三维场景渲染。在Cesium中,可以使用Cesium.CzmlDataSource()实例加载和解析CZML数据源。 CzmlDataSource 使用CZML(Cesium Zoomable M...
CZML是一种JSON格式的字符串,用于描述与时间有关的动画场景,CZML包含点、线、地标、模型和其他的一些图形元素,并指明了这些元素如何随时间而变化。Cesium拥有一套富客户端API,通过CZML采用数据驱动的方式,不用写代码我就可以使用通用的Cesium viewer构建出丰富的场景。某种程度上说,,Cesium和CZML的关系就像Google Earth...
Cesium地形格式是一种用于在Cesium中呈现地形数据的特定格式。Cesium支持多种地形格式,包括SRTM(Shuttle Radar Topography Mission)和CZML(Cesium Language)。SRTM是一种用于获取全球地形数据的雷达测绘技术,而CZML是一种用于描述Cesium场景的JSON格式。 1. SRTM地形格式 SRTM地形格式基于高程数据,通过网格化和插值技术将地形...
CZML是一个开放的格式。我们希望有更多的程序能使用CZML,同时期待有一天它也能成为OGC一样的标准。 可以通过czml-writer来生成CZML,这个程序维护在Github上。 我们将CZML标准以及它的相应实现分为4个部分: CZML Structure -- CZML文档的整体结构 CZML Content --内容 ...
CZML是一种JSON格式的字符串,用于描述与时间有关的动画场景,CZML包含点、线、地标、模型、和其他的一些图形元素,并指明了这些元素如何随时间而变化。某种程度上说, Cesium 和 CZML的关系就像 Google Earth 和 KML。[摘] 注:1、时间间隔,时间使用距离起始时间(epoch); ...
在Cesium上面绘制实体形状有两种方式:一个是通过Entity的方式来绘制,还有一种是通过CZML的JSON格式数据来绘制,下面就演示这两种方式。 第一种 Entity添加实体 首先来看看官网关于Entity的描述,如下图:点击前往官网 在这里插入图片描述 可以看到,entity可以创建多种实体(立方体,圆柱体,椭圆,点,线等等),每一个实体创建...
Cesium中,轨迹漫游的核心是借助CZML格式,CZML是Cesium团队制定的一种用来描述动态场景的JSON架构语言,可以用来描述点、线、多边形、体、模型及其他图元,同时定义它们是怎样随时间变化的,参考CZML Structure · AnalyticalGraphicsInc/czml-writer Wiki (github.com) ...
event:czml data:{// packet one}event:czml data:{// packet two} 当浏览器接收到一个packet后就会发出一个事件,事件中会包含刚刚接收到了数据。这样我们就可以通过增量的方式高效的处理CZML数据。 目前为止,我们都是使用一个packet包来描述一个对象,这个packet包含了所有这个对象的图形属性。我们还可以使用其他的...